
Music, ok. Many shots are focused on Briony, and the background music (or maybe just sound) of those shots is just like horror music to give audience sense of suspense. I believe some soft piano rhythm will be good subsitute for this occasion and gives more of sadness and sutlety. Too much loud typing sound is also very disturbing, although it implies Briony types and writes the novel, but too much is too much. Another complaint is too many repeats of the same key words. One "Come back, come back to me" is impressive, and make the audience relive the movie again and again. Twice is a bit over and make it seem not that important. What about 3 times? Find another screenplay writer!
But generally this is a good movie. The young girl playing Briony beautifully portrays a sensitive young writer, and let the audience, without knowing what the story is all about, expects she would be a successful writer.
